    I posted on here a month or so ago, that Harley Davidson surveyed us (me) when I bought a new motorcycle in 2001. It asked questions like would we rather see a HD (Harley Davidson) version of an Expedition or a F-250 or F-350, two wheel drive or four wheel drive, etc. etc. Then it had a space to write comments. Ford has published a release that said the survey asked for more pulling power and more torque, even on a 4x4 chassis. That's what they came out with.

    However, I've said it before (and believe it, if you want, or not) the HD (Harley Davidson) version for next year is scheduled to go back on a F-150 chassis.

    I also found it very interesting to see the total number of units that they plan to build this year. These truely will be a limited edition version. And to have your choice between a F-250 or F-350 and two wheel or four wheel drive.
